Has former Vanderbilt QB Diego Pavia been picked in the NFL Draft? Why the Heisman runner-up hasn't been picked.

Former Vanderbilt football quarterback and 2025 Heisman Trophy runner-up Diego Pavia remains on the 2026 NFL Draft board after the first three rounds. Pavia, who led Vanderbilt to a record-setting season last year, finished second to No. 1 overall pick and fellow quarterback Fernando Mendoza of national champion Indiana in the Heisman voting.

Pavia, the outspoken 24-year-old also made headlines off the field, such as when he criticized Heisman voters on Instagram. Where is Diego Pavia expected to be drafted? Pavia is projected as a seventh-round pick or to be an undrafted free agent.

Where does Diego Pavia rank on Mel Kiper's big board? Pavia was ranked the No. 12 quarterback on the ESPN analyst's board behind Mendoza, Ty Simpson, Carson Beck, Garrett Nussemeier, Drew Allar, Cole Payton, Taylen Green, Cade Klubnik, Luke Altmyer, Sawyer Robertson and Haynes King.
